Stauff Flow Monitoring, Type SGF

The Stauff positive displacement Flow Meter, available through Hytec Fluid Technology (HFT), offers a comprehensive solution for high accuracy and high pressure flow monitoring.

The units are available for flow ranges from 0,002 litres/min to 250 litres/min and are suitable for pressures up to 450 bar (6500 PSI). It is possible to integrate the units direct into the hydraulic circuit.

Furthermore a special digital display is available to visualise the flow.

This flow meter is ideal for applications such as hydraulic test stands, grease, ink, lubrication systems, diesel, fuel, kerosene and brake fluid.

  • Materials:
    • Body: EN-GJS-400-15 (EN 1563) / Stainless Steel 1.4305
    • Bearings: Ball, Spindle
    • Sealings: FPM (Viton®), NBR (Buna-N®), PTFE, EPDM
  • Accuracy: ± 0.3% of measured value at 20 cSt
  • Repeatability: ± 0.05% of measured value at 20 cSt
  • Power Supply: 10 to 28 V DC
  • Max. Operating Pressure:
    • Cast Iron housing: 315 bar / 4568 PSI
    • Stainless Steel housing: 450 bar / 6526 PSI
  • Medium Temperature: -40° C to 120° C
  • Viscosity Range: Up to 100 000 cSt (depends on type)
